About 4 The Croft

A plain-English summary derived from public records, EPC certificates, sold prices and local data.

4 The Croft is a two-bedroom semi-detached house in Sedgley, Dudley, Dudley (DY3 1LZ). It has a recorded floor area of 74 m² (around 797 sq ft), construction records dating it to 1950-1966 and council tax band A. The latest certificate (April 2021) shows a D (score 67), on the cusp of jumping into the C band. The recommended improvements would lift it to B (score 83), a 2-band jump. The home occupies a cul-de-sac position.

One planning record on file: tree works approved in 2017. Past consents include tree works, meaningful when judging how the property has evolved. Across 2021–2023, sale prices on this property compounded at 13.5% per year. Today's modelled estimate of £203,000 is 15.3% above the 2023 sale price. On a £-per-square-foot basis, the last sale (£221/sq ft) was about 82.8% above the typical sold price in the postcode. Last sale on file: £176,000 in July 2023.
